A set of six Chinese 'Imari' Export plates, Qing Dynasty, 18th century

each circular everted and gilt rim painted in underglaze-blue with scrolling foliage, the centre painted with a rectangular scroll enclosing blossoms and bamboo, the cavetto highlighted in orange and gilt with peonies, the blossom flowers and bamboo leaves to the centre further highlighted in orange and gilt enclosing an enamelled green bird in flight, the reverse painted with sprays of stylised foliage, 22,2cm diameter
